We went camping there over the long-weekend, we had a family camping weekend.
We traveled on the R59 all the way and the road is near perfect and a nice drive from the east-rand with no tolls.
They where fully booked and yet you would not think so as the layout of the resort is well done.
It's a great venue and there is really nothing to complain about, it's kept neat and tidy, the ablutions are cleaned almost 6 times a day.
The Restaurant makes awesome food (You have to book in advance)
The game drive is nice and they have lots of lions.
The pool is extremely cold but it should be better by end of November.
Their little shop has all the basics in small quantities but no bread.

It is bushveld so there are not really any large trees, take something for shade
